Job description: The production technician performs production processes to fulfill the service needs of individual restoration projects and maintains the professional appearance of SERVPRO equipment, as well as an assigned service vehicle. By providing quality, consistent, efficient work, the production technician represents the best in the cleanup and restoration industry. We have a sincere drive toward the goal of helping make fire and water damage “Like it never even happened®!” Primary Responsibilities Inventory and load the work vehicle with equipment, products, and supplies needed for each project. Maintain a clean and organized vehicle and clean equipment appearance. Prepare rooms/areas for work activities. Set up staging area and equipment for each project. Perform production processes as directed. Adhere to safety and risk management guidelines at all times. Communicate with crew chief and other technicians to maintain efficient production processes. Perform end-of-day/end-of-job cleanup and breakdown. Leave jobsite with a clean and orderly appearance. Position Requirements Effective oral communication Basic math skills Experience in cleaning/restoration preferred High school diploma/GED IICRC certifications preferred Ability to lift a minimum of 50 pounds regularly, occasionally up to 100 pounds with assistance Ability to climb ladders, work at ceiling heights, work in tight spaces (e.g., crawl spaces, attics) Ability to sit/stand/walk for prolonged periods of time Ability to repetitively push/pull/lift/carry objects Ability to work with/around cleaning products/chemicals Ability to travel locally and out of state when necessary Ability to successfully complete a background check subject to applicable law Perks/Benefits: Full time plus overtime Call out bonuses Paid vacations Health Insurance 401k Our Production Technicians average income for 2020 was over $40,000*. *This an hourly position with lots of opportunities to make much more than the hourly rate provides.
